Arctic Summer

on BBC One London

Baffin Island Last summer 12 boys from Clifton
College, Bristol, left England on the first-ever British school expedition to go to Baffin Island in Arctic Canada. In the first of two films
MIKE MILLER and PHILIP JARDINE tell the story of the week they spent at the Eskimo settlement of Pangnirtung, finding out how the modern Eskimo lives and works. Though its population is under 1,000, Pangnirtung has a modern school, a church, even a theological college...Law and order is the responsibility of a single mountie.
